Or it could be that Pixar was trying to make a statement (note how EVE looks like a modern I book if it were egg-shaped?), invoke some tropes (Auto's voice is done by the Apple voice generator, and I'm 100% certain the HAL thing was intentional), and take advantage of the utterly cute (both Johnny 5 and WALL-E).

There's a difference between tribute and theft, and Pixar didn't get close to the latter. Let's go over the difference, shall we?

WALL-E Doesn't:
-Have a weapons-grade laser on his back.
-Have a body type even close to resembling J5.
-Require input.
-Talk.
-Have a third wheel on his back.
-Spout inane cultural references and depend on that for its humor value.

J5 Doesn't:
-Collapse into a box.
-Compact trash.
-Have a pet cockroach.
-Chirp.
-Collect solar energy.
-Have replaceable parts.

Rather large list for 'major copyright infringement'
